Jennifer Lopez, Ben Affleck, & Jennifer Garner Come Together to Cheer On Daughter Seraphina at Her School Play

Jennifer Lopez, Ben Affleck, and Jennifer Garner have become major blended family goals — and it’s not just when they pick up or drop off one child at another’s houses. They are also coming together for special occasions, and we love to see it. Jennifer Lopez joined the former couple recently to see their youngest daughter Seraphina perform in her school play. And honestly, how special is that for Seraphina to see her parents sitting in the same auditorium despite their differences?

The 14-year-old also had at least two siblings at the show. Lopez was seen strolling with and hugging her stepdaughter Violet, 17, and also her 15-year-old son Maximillian. Lopez shares Max and his twin sister Emme (who was not spotted at the event) with her ex-husband Marc Anthony. Affleck and Garner also share a son, Samuel, and it is unclear if the 10-year-old saw his sister take to the stage.

We can’t confirm if the Jennifers caught up at the special event, but there doesn’t seem to be any bad blood there. What we can surmise is that the two were not in contact beforehand since they had very different ideas when it came to the dress code.

    This is far from the first time this trio has come together for their kids. In January, they went to one of Seraphina’s musical performances together, and they seem to be taking this whole co-parenting thing in stride.

    In her Dec. 2022 cover story for Vogue, J. Lo called Garner “an amazing co-parent.” Just a month earlier, an insider told Us Weekly that the two really have formed a “friendship” and that Garner “can’t believe how sweet” Lopez is to her kids.

    “Now that Jen and Jen have been co-parenting, they’ve been getting to know each other better and have formed a very new friendship,” the source said. We love to see it!
